Scientists discover how mitochondria change throughout the day

An international team of scientists from Argentina, the United States, and the United Kingdom has made a surprising discovery by observing the changes that occur inside neurons that regulate the biological clock. Published in the journal Current Biology, the research was conducted on Drosophila melanogaster, a key model organism that shares biological mechanisms with humans. Using volumetric electron microscopy, a technology not available in Argentina, the researchers were able to see for the first time how the shape, number, and volume of mitochondria change throughout the day. It turns out that in the morning, the mitochondria in the 'clock' neurons are small, round, and vigorous, but by night they become elongated and fuse. 'This speaks to how the physiological state of the cells changes, and this is something no one had seen before,' explained the study's leader, Fernanda Ceriani. The researchers also found that the number of synapses (connections between neurons) and the probability of neurotransmitter vesicles fusing with the membrane to be released change over the course of a day. This discovery opens a new line of research and helps to understand the importance of respecting sleep-wake cycles. A malfunction in this entire system can lead to weakened immunity, insomnia, depression, diabetes, and reduced cognitive performance. 'When you understand that this process is happening, you can somehow comprehend why it's so important to respect sleep and wakefulness cycles,' Ceriani concluded.
